How do I rewrite In 7=y as an exponential equation? I kind of forgot how to do these

Respuesta :

goddessboi goddessboi
  • 12-01-2022

Answer:

[tex]e^y=7[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ex]ln(7)=y[/tex]

[tex]e^{ln(7)}=e^y[/tex]

[tex]7=e^y[/tex]

Raising e to both sides cancels out the natural logarithm on the left side and we have our exponential form. This works with other bases (recall that the natural logarithm, ln, has base e)
